  18. Handy, cheap and nice smelling micro-towel. I always made sure I have few on me at any time . Refreshing , stays moist for few hours, can be washed and reused. Whether you feel sweaty, oily , soiled you appreciate having it on you . comes in 3 sizes ay 9, 13 and 16 baht, can be found in 7/11 and the like not where other toiletries are but curiously where dairy items are shelved. Don't ask me why. I even went as far as bringing few of those home.
